Frequently Asked Questions
Is Retro Recipe Cereal safe for people with kidney disease?
Retro Recipe Cereal is rated Avoid for CKD patients. Avoid or eat rarely if you have CKD. With 150.0mg phosphorus, 750.0mg sodium, and 0.0mg potassium per 100.0g serving, it is best avoided or eaten only on special occasions. Always confirm with your nephrologist or renal dietitian.
How much phosphorus is in Retro Recipe Cereal?
A 100.0g serving of Retro Recipe Cereal contains 150mg of phosphorus, which is approximately 15% of the recommended 1,000mg daily limit for CKD Stage 3-4 patients.
How much sodium is in Retro Recipe Cereal?
Per 100.0g serving, Retro Recipe Cereal provides 750mg of sodium — about 33% of the 2,300mg daily sodium limit recommended for kidney patients.
How much potassium is in Retro Recipe Cereal?
Retro Recipe Cereal contains 0mg of potassium per 100.0g serving, equivalent to about 0% of the daily 2,000mg potassium limit for CKD Stage 3-4 patients.
